Output 645fc4e68f5d26f445dabbd3d845c8d5e6d8069ce7acafe871f76190577ad9cf:0

value
3437268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3893772a4756e8e569d126e5533ce7e82f720848 OP_EQUAL
address
36rARNJNd5PpgcchUWuiJFEMJHCo3ThJLS
transaction
645fc4e68f5d26f445dabbd3d845c8d5e6d8069ce7acafe871f76190577ad9cf
confirmations
307927
spent
true